Good but repetitive and lacks an ending
I have fond memories of Daemonifuge and still have the first two black and white TPBs on my shelf. So I was eager to pick this book up since it not only included book 3 (which I missed) but also colorized the entire series. Printed on good glossy paper with a nice binding, this edition is a definite improvement over the old paperbacks and of course it is in color. The coloring is well done, it adds to the original black and white art while keeping the mood, and is not gaudy or distracting. But content-wise it kind of stalls out. I already felt that book 2 was weaker, the change in artist is distracting and it retreads a lot of the same ground as book 1. Book 3 is even more so, the art is more stylized and at odds with the more realistic art in the first half, and worst of all there's no ending. Stern just escapes from her latest foe and the journey continues. Except that the journey does not continue, there never was a book 4. So Daemonfuge is well-made, good looking and parts of it are a great 40k story, but other parts drag and the story ends on a loose end. Whether or not that is worth your $40 is up to you.
